ホームページ > バックエンド開発 > PHPチュートリアル > php を早急にマスターする必要があること。衝動的な人間にならないでください。

php を早急にマスターする必要があること。衝動的な人間にならないでください。

WBOY
リリース: 2016-06-13 12:51:20
オリジナル
856 人が閲覧しました

PHP をマスターする必要があること。衝動的な人間にならないでください。
1. 文法: コードを作成するときは、IDE エディターが次の規則に従って特定の行でエラーを報告できるようにする必要があります。エラーメッセージ
メッセージは文法上の誤りが何であるかを認識し、修正があるかどうかを認識します。
2. コマンド: PHP のいくつかの一般的なコマンドとその一般的なオプションに精通している必要があり、それらのコマンドを自分で実行してください
。 php.exe -h これらのコマンドをすべて使用したことがない場合は、実際には PHP についてあまり知識がありません。
3. ツール: Eclipse、Netbeans、zend、
など、少なくとも 1 つの IDE 開発ツールの使用に習熟している必要があります。 editplus、ultraedit (プロジェクト管理、共通オプションの設定、PHP プラグインのインストールと構成を含む)、および
デバッグ。
4. API: PHP のコア API は非常に大きいですが、次のような内容がいくつかあります。よく理解しておく必要があります。そうしないと、PHP を上手に使用することができなくなります。

・ファイルディレクトリ処理機能パッケージの80%以上の機能を柔軟に利用可能。
- 日付と時刻関数の 80% 以上の関数を柔軟に使用できます
- 数学関数ライブラリの 100% コンテンツ。
- ネットワーク ライブラリのコンテンツの 60% 以上は、各機能の機能を比較的よく理解しています。
- コンテンツの 60% 以上が文字列処理関数、特にさまざまな処理関数に基づいています。
- コンテンツの 90% 以上が正規表現関数、特に各種正規処理
- コンテンツの 40% 以上が一部のセキュリティ ライブラリに含まれており、セキュリティとの関わりがなければ PHP をマスターすることは不可能です
- XML 処理。SAX、DOM、JDOM の長所と短所を理解しており、それらの 1 つを使用して XML 解析とコンテンツ処理を完了できる。
- コンテンツの 80% 以上がグラフィックスおよび画像関数ライブラリに含まれており、特に一部の画像生成と処理
- MySQL データベースのコンテンツの 90% 以上が関数、特にさまざまなデータを処理する関数
- 内容の90%以上は配列処理関数、特に各種演算処理関数
- 他の PEAR、PECL、および一部の拡張クラス ライブラリのコンテンツの 80% 以上、特に一般的に使用されるクラスの処理
- さまざまなニーズに合わせてさまざまな関数ライブラリを見つけます。
5. テスト: phpunit を使用してテスト ケースを作成し、コードの自動テストを完了することに慣れている必要があります。
6. 管理: プロジェクトのコンパイル、phpdoc の生成、生成、バージョン管理、自動テストなどのプロジェクト管理の一般的なタスクを完了するには、xinc、phing などの使用に精通している必要があります。
7. トラブルシューティング: 異常情報に基づいて、問題の原因とおおよその場所を迅速に特定できる必要があります。
8. 感想: PHP を使用して開発されたシステムが本物の PHP システムになるためには、OOP の主な要件を習得する必要があります。
9. 標準: プログラムの可読性を高めるために、書かれたコードは一般的なコーディング標準に準拠する必要があります。
10. 博学: OOA、OOD、MS SQL Server、Oracle、Zendframework、cakephp、symfony、テンプレート テクノロジーなどの一般的なテクノロジーをマスターし、ソフトウェア アーキテクチャの設計アイデア、検索エンジンの最適化、キャッシュ システムの設計、Web サイトの負荷分散、システムをマスターします。パフォーマンスチューニングなど実践的な技術。

上記に基づくと、PHP と Java の間に違いは見つかりません。 PHP、Java、.net については学ぶべきことがたくさんあります。
性急な人は、「PHP 言語はダメだ。Java、C#、VB.NET を学ぶべきだ」と言う傾向があります。 - それができないのはあなたです! ?
衝動的な人は、「PHP、Java、C#、VB.NET のどれが優れているのですか?」と尋ねる傾向があります。よく学びさえすれば、どちらも優れています。
せっかちな人は「何を学べばいいの?」と尋ねる傾向があります。尋ねないでください。
衝動的な人は、「PHP でお金を稼ぐ方法はありますか? 銀行強盗をすることをお勧めします。」と尋ねる傾向があります。

php
-----解決策--------------------------------
この投稿は最終的に xuzuning によって編集され、2013-03-14 21:21:21 によって書かれました。大変ですね
ごめんなさい、私は衝動的な人間であるほうが良いです
-----解決策---------
投稿者が書いたことは理にかなっていますが、すべてを実行するのは少し難しいです。
------解決策---------
個人的には、投稿者の提案は非常に良いと思いますが、いくつかの制限があります。 。 。 。 。

-----解決策--------------------------------
もちろんマスターするのが一番ですが、今マスターしなければならないことが多すぎて、今日マスターしたことは明日には忘れられるかもしれません
-----解決策------ -------------
習得しなければならない技術はたくさんありますが、結局のところエネルギーが足りません。
-----解決策---------
技術を習得する必要がありますが、
テクノロジーとは、複雑な関数名をたくさん覚えなければならないということではありません
テクノロジーだからといって、開発を行うのにリファレンスマニュアルが必要ないというわけではありません
テクノロジーとは、巨大な IDE を使用する必要があるという意味ではありません
技術者として広い視野を持つことは悪いことではありません。何事も中途半端にやるのは間違いです。

-----解決策--------------------------------
いいね、他にもたくさんあります、見てください~~


-----解決策--------------------------------
たくさんありますが、私はこの方法で学びました、それも天才です、何も学ぶことを心配する必要はありません!
関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ート